Abstract
Forty-four thyroid autonomously hyperfunctioning adenomas were analyze d to assess the frequency of mutations occurring in the TSH receptor ( TSHR). PCR-amplified fragments encompassing the entire exon 10 of the TSHR gene were obtained from the genomic DNA extracted from the tumors and their adjacent normal tissues and were examined by direct nucleot ide sequencing. Point mutations were found in 9 of the 44 adenomas exa mined (20%). One mutation occurred in codon 619 (Asp to Gly), four in codon 623 (three were Ala to Ser, one Ala to Val substitution), two in codon 632 (both Thr to Ile), and two in codon 633 (Asp to Tyr or His) . All the alterations were located in a part of the gene coding for an area including the third intracellular loop and the sixth transmembra ne domain of the TSH receptor. All mutations were somatic and heterozy gotic, and none was simultaneous with alterations of ras or gsp oncoge nes. Thus, our data show that in our series of 44 hyperfunctioning thy roid adenomas, a somatic mutation of the TSHR, responsible for the con stitutive activation of the cAMP pathway, occurs in 20% of the tumors.
